Bahasa perakit: Perbedaan antara revisi
Konten dihapus Konten ditambahkan
kTidak ada ringkasan suntingan |
k →top: pembersihan kosmetika dasar |
||
(17 revisi perantara oleh 13 pengguna tidak ditampilkan) | |||
Baris 1:
'''Assembler''' adalah sebuah [[program komputer]] untuk
Selain menterjemahkan instruksi assembly mnemonic menjadi [[opcode]], assembler juga menyediakan kemampuan untuk menggunakan nama simbolik untuk lokasi memori (menghindari penghitungan rumit dan pembaruan alamat secara manual ketika sebuah program diubah sedikit), dan fasilitas [[makro]] untuk melakukan penggantian textual
Assembler jauh lebih mudah ditulis daripada [[kompilator]] untuk [[bahasa tingkat-tinggi]], dan telah tersedia sejak [[1950-an]]. Assembler modern, terutama untuk arsitektur berdasarkan [[RISC]], seperti [[arsitektur MIPS]], Sun [[SPARC]], dan HP [[PA-RISC]], mengoptimalkan [[penjadwalan instruksi]] untuk menggunakan [[pipeline CPU]] secara efisien.
== Lihat pula ==
* [[kompilator]]
* [[bahasa assembly x86|assembler x86]]
* bahasa asembly z80
== Pranala luar ==
Baris 15 ⟶ 16:
* [http://www.program-transformation.org/ The Program Transformation Wiki]
* [http://c2.com/cgi/wiki?LearningAssemblyLanguage C2: Learning Assembly Language]
{{Authority control}}
[[Kategori:Assembler| ]]
[[Kategori:Bahasa pemrograman]]
[[en:Assembly language#Assembler]]
[[
|